Question:
can this hitch be used to raise pintle hitch height ?
asked by: Darren T
0
Expert Reply:
Yes the B&W Pintle Hook Mounting Plate # BWPMHD14005 can absolutely be used in the rise position to raise the height of your pintle hook.
This mounting plate fits 2" hitches, has a 15" shank and mounting holes that measure 3-3/8" apart on center horizontally and 1-3/4" apart on center vertically, which is the same pattern as the bolt holes on Pintle Hook # C48215.
You will also need Pin and Clip # PC3 to secure it to your hitch.
